Apple's visionOS 26 brings eye-scrolling and support for PS VR2 controllers

Apple has unveiled visionOS 26 for the Apple Vision Pro, introducing exciting new features like compatibility with PlayStation VR2 Sense controllers, enabling gaming capabilities. Users can now place widgets anywhere in virtual space and enjoy shared spatial experiences, such as watching movies or collaborating via FaceTime. The update enhances Apple's controversial Personas, making them appear more lifelike, and introduces eye-scrolling functionality for easy navigation through documents and apps.
